Job Description:
*JOB OVERVIEW:* Under the direction of the Director or Manager
of Radiology Services, the Medical Director, and the nuclear
medicine team, performs Nuclear Medicine exams, Stress Tests, and
Spectral CT exams at a technical level requiring limited or no
supervision. Performs a variety of procedures that requires
independent judgement for the preparation, calibration, and
administration of radiopharmaceuticals, as well as performing
quality control, diagnostic and therapeutic imaging
procedures.*AREA OF ASSIGNMENT:* Radiology*HOURS OF* *WORK:*
Variable*RESPONSIBLE TO:* Director / Manager,
Radiology*PREREQUISITES:** Graduate of a program accredited by
JCERT or the JRCNMT, or Registered with the NMTCB or with ARRT, or
equivalent training, required.* Current Nuclear Medicine CNMT
and/or ARRT(N) Certification, required.* Current WA State
Radiologic Technologist Certification, required.* Current American
Heart Association BLS for Healthcare Providers, required.* 1 year
of working in Nuclear Medicine, preferred.* Radiology Technologist
RT(R) Certification, preferred.* CT Technologist RT(CT)
Certification Preferred or obtain Certification within 1 year of
employment, required.*QUALIFICATIONS:** Flexibility, adaptability

imaging data electronically.*PERFORMANCE RESPONSIBILITIES:**
Demonstrates proficiency in all nuclear medicine procedures, using
initiative in special positioning needs of individual patients.*
Practices good radiation safety procedure pertaining to the
preparation, handling, administration, and disposal of
radiopharmaceuticals. (ALARA)* Performs Spectral CT exams that
include IV and Oral contrast utilizing all screening and safety
precautions.* Facilities Cardiology PA's with stress test to
include: setting up for the exam, hooking a patient up to a 12-lead
EKG,* Performs/maintains all department records pertaining to
quality control, radiation monitoring and surveys, and radioactive
materials handling.* Orders radiopharmaceuticals according to both
prescribed schedules, and on a stat basis.* Operates all imaging
and auxiliary equipment according to written procedures/protocols,
demonstrating proficiency on all equipment.* Reports/records all
equipment problems promptly, and initiates service calls as
necessary.* Responsible for documenting pertinent clinical history
and symptoms.* Participates in the utilization and support of the
PACS systems.* Utilize computer systems to obtain lab values, enter
exam charges, schedule patients, enter orders, access reports,
etc.* Assists in the writing and revision of procedures/protocols.*
Assists in evaluating and standardizing new procedures.* Maintain a
working knowledge of medications used in nuclear medicine*
Responsible for the physiological monitoring and care of patients
during nuclear medicine procedures.* Maintain proficiency in
starting IV lines and follows proper injection procedure.* Takes
on-call responsibility as scheduled and arrives within 30 minutes
of notification* Maintains a positive relationship with physicians
and their staff.* Develop and maintain respectful relationships
with all customers.* Transports patients as necessary, utilizing
appropriate safety resources.* Provide documentation of personal
credentials per department policy and maintain education record.*
Other related duties as assigned.*Please apply directly to our
